KS4 lesson for Unit 2: The Universal Hero, in Component 1: Myth and Religion, of the OCR Classical Civilisation GCSE. The lesson objective is to analyse the lesser adventures of Hercules - focusing on his battle with Achelous, Nessus and finally the hero’s death.

Accessible for all ability groups and the resources are easily differentiated for more and less academically able students.

This lesson includes…

  • An introduction to Ovid and the prescribed literary source, Metamorphoses.
  • A focused study of the myth of Hercules and Achelous, with a video and visual source to support learning. Please note: This requires the use of the OCR Literary Source Booklet for the prescribed source Ovid’s Metamorphoses.
  • Study questions on the myth of Hercules and Achelous as told in Ovid’s Metamorphoses.
  • A focused study of the myth of Hercules and Nessus, with a video and visual source to support learning. Please note: This requires the use of the OCR Literary Source Booklet for the prescribed source Ovid’s Metamorphoses.
  • Study questions on the myth of Hercules and Nessus as told in Ovid’s Metamorphoses.
  • Chronological ordering activity for the myth of Hercules and Nessus
  • A focused study of the myth of Hercules’ death, with study questions and a focused study of how heroic Hercules is in these lesser adventures. Please note: This requires the use of the OCR Literary Source Booklet for the prescribed source Ovid’s Metamorphoses.
